Funeral service for Billy Joe Little, Jr., age 60, of Hartselle will be 2:00 p.m. on Wednesday, March 4, 2026, at Parkway Funeral Home Chapel with Wally Bryant officiating. The family will receive friends for two hours prior to service. Interment will be in Burningtree Memorial Gardens. Guestbook available at www.parkwayfunerals.com.
Billy passed away peacefully in his home surrounded by his loving family. He is leaving behind a legacy of love, devotion, and quiet strength that will forever live on in the hearts of those who knew him.
A devoted husband to his loving wife, Katrina, he built a life grounded in laughter, loyalty, and unwavering love. He was a proud and dedicated father to his daughters, Heather and Haley, who were the light of his life and his greatest accomplishments. Nothing brought him more joy than being “Pawpaw” to his cherished grandchildren, Aubreonna and Kamden. They could always count on him for a warm hug, a soft kiss, or silly dance move. He found his greatest joy in the laughter and achievements of his grandchildren, never missing a chance to show how proud he was of them.
Family was the center of his life.
He was a loving son to his mother, Ruby, carrying forward the values of family, resilience, and kindness that she instilled in him. He was also a brother, uncle, cousin, and friend to many. The kind of man who could walk into a room and instantly make it brighter by just his presence.
A life long fan of Alabama Crimson Tide football, he cheered passionately on Saturdays, proudly calling out “Roll Tide” whether his team was winning big or keeping everyone on the edge of their seats. He loved spending time on the golf course, enjoying the camaraderie as much as the game itself. He love listening to rock-n-roll music especially AC/DC.
Though he was taken from this world too young, the love he gave so freely will continue to guide and comfort his family in the years ahead.
Mr. Little, who died Sunday, March 1, 2026, at his residence, was born January 13, 1966, in Alabama to Billy Joe Little, Sr. and Ruby Lee Chesser Little. He was preceded in death by his father.
He is survived by his wife, Katrina Little; mother, Ruby Little; daughters, Heather Little and Haley Champion (Jake); three sisters, Debbie Milam, Bobbie Lucia, and Linda Little; and two grandchildren, Aubreonna Parker and Kamden Bradley.
Pallbearers will be Jake Champion, Jason Lucia, Frankie Massey, Jeff Chambers, Rick Williams, and Rob Chesser. Honorary pallbearer will be Joe Chesser.
Billy Joe Little’s memory will forever be a blessing. He will be deeply missed, forever loved, and always remembered.
